I’ve rented vehicles in many countries over the years.  Invariably there are bad surprises and in fact I can’t think of a positive.  Sometimes an upgrade might happen but usually I’m dealing with bald tires, dubious excess charges or outright dishonesty.  The vans Francesco and I were offered in Rome looked as if they had been used for stock car racing.  ‘We’re professionals’ we said, ‘offering a professional service.  We can’t carry our customers in these’.  After much toing and froing we obtained a very nice VW but I was stuck with the battered Fiat.  What to do!?

Our week in the Appennini was a delight.  Highlights included the Rave di Giumenta Blanca on Mt Amaro and the beautiful, near deserted village of Castel del Monte.  The café bar there gave us a superb breakfast spread and après ski hospitality though it’s the only bar I have ever been in anywhere that didn’t have a single bottle of Scots Whisky.

At the end Francesco and I happily relinquished responsibility for the rental vans at Rome airport.  Because mine was so battered the full length dent I’d put in it  on a  narrow mountain road whilst listening to Harley wasn’t even noticed.
